Google Announces Major AI Leadership Reshuffle, DeepMind Chief Steps Down

Google is undergoing a significant leadership shake-up in its AI division, with DeepMind chief Demis Hassabis stepping down from his role and other central developers departing. This restructuring aims to sharpen Google's focus in artificial intelligence.

After 27 years, Jeff Dean is leaving Google: His ‘goodbye email’ explains why

Jeff Dean is leaving Google after 27 years, closing a run that took him from employee number 30 to chief scientist. He built MapReduce and BigTable, started the TPU program, founded Google Brain and co-led Gemini. Now he's CEO of Discovery Loop, chasing AI that improves itself. His farewell note lists it all, plus 18 office moves and Monterey bike rides.
